TABLE OF CONTENTS
What is the Best Timeframe for EA Testing?
The best timeframe for EA testing varies based on the trading strategy employed and market conditions. Selecting the appropriate timeframe is crucial for the reliability of the results obtained during testing.
Understanding Timeframes in EA Testing
Choosing the right timeframe is fundamental for effective EA testing. I have found that the timeframe can significantly influence the performance of an Expert Advisor (EA). For instance, a strategy designed for scalping would typically perform best on a one-minute or five-minute chart, while a trend-following strategy may yield better results on an hourly or daily chart. Tip: See our complete guide to Best Practices For Testing Mt5 Eas Before Trading for all the essentials.
Short-Term vs. Long-Term Testing
In my experience, short-term testing often captures quick market movements, which can be beneficial for fast-paced trading strategies. Conversely, long-term testing can help identify the sustainability of a strategy over time. It is essential to align the testing timeframe with the strategy’s objectives. For example, a moving average crossover strategy may show different results on a 15-minute chart compared to a daily chart.
Factors Influencing Timeframe Selection
Several factors play a role in determining the best timeframe for EA testing. I have learned that market volatility, trading style, and the specific goals of the EA are all critical considerations. An EA that aims to profit from high volatility may require testing on shorter timeframes, while a more conservative approach could benefit from longer timeframes.
Market Conditions
Different market conditions can impact the effectiveness of an EA. I have observed that during high volatility periods, shorter timeframes can lead to more significant gains, but they also increase the risk of larger drawdowns. Conversely, in stable market conditions, longer timeframes tend to produce more consistent results.
Backtesting and Optimization Techniques
Effective backtesting and optimization techniques are essential for maximizing the performance of an EA. I often recommend using multiple timeframes during testing to gain a comprehensive view of the strategy’s performance across different market scenarios. This approach allows for better fine-tuning of parameters and can lead to improved overall results.
Using Multiple Timeframes
Employing a multi-timeframe analysis can provide a more nuanced understanding of how an EA performs. For example, I might develop a strategy based on daily signals but use a four-hour chart for entry and exit points. This combination can lead to better trade timing and improved outcomes. Additionally, using tools like [MT5’s Strategy Tester](https://www.metatrader5.com/en/terminal/help/algotrading/strategy_tester) can facilitate this process by allowing simultaneous testing across various timeframes.
Conclusion: Finding Your Optimal Timeframe
Finding the optimal timeframe for EA testing requires careful consideration of various factors. I have found that experimenting with different timeframes and analyzing the results can lead to a better understanding of how the EA performs under various conditions. Ultimately, the key is to align your testing approach with your trading goals and risk tolerance.
Frequently Asked Questions (FAQs)
What is the best timeframe for EA testing?
The best timeframe for EA testing depends on the trading strategy being employed. Shorter timeframes may be suitable for scalping strategies, while longer timeframes may be better for trend-following or swing trading strategies.
How can I optimize my EA testing process?
Optimizing the EA testing process involves using multiple timeframes, fine-tuning parameters, and employing effective backtesting techniques to ensure that the strategy performs well across various market conditions.
Why is timeframe selection important in EA testing?
Timeframe selection is crucial in EA testing because it directly affects the results obtained. Different timeframes can yield varying performance metrics, which can influence decision-making and future trading strategies.
Next Steps: To deepen your understanding of EA testing, consider exploring best practices for testing EAs on MT5, common pitfalls in EA testing, and efficient backtesting methods. These resources will provide valuable insights to enhance your trading strategies.
Disclaimer
This article is for educational purposes only. It is not financial advice. Forex trading involves significant risk and may not be suitable for everyone. Past performance doesn’t guarantee future results. Always do your own research and speak to a licensed financial advisor before making any trading decisions. Forex92 is not responsible for any losses you may incur based on the information shared here.